This Friday, May 19 is presented in preview at Cannes, Flo, a film retracing the life of the navigator who tragically disappeared in a helicopter accident eight years ago.

In Cannes (Alpes-Maritimes), meet the Flo film crew on the sailboat with which Florence Arthaud won the Route du Rhum. It is also the boat that was used for the film. For the actress, Stéphane Caillard, it was a challenge to embody the little bride of the Atlantic. “I basically knew the icon she was and became after the Route du Rhum, I was a little small to see her arrival. She is a very dense character, a woman in all her complexity and therefore in all her beauty”she says.

A strong and free woman

Florence Arthaud, free woman and exceptional sailor. Eight years after her disappearance, the French have not forgotten her. “The courage of this woman. The pugnacity she may have had”, said a woman. The film Flo retraces the career of the woman who lived at 100 miles an hour, with decisive encounters, such as Olivier de Kersauson. Filming ended six months ago in Brittany, but the sailor’s family did not like the project. His daughter attempted legal action to have a say in the script, to no avail. The release is scheduled for next November.
